現在完成時
1,概念:過去發生或已經完成的動作對現在造成的影響或結果,或從過去已經開始,持續到現在的動作或 狀態。
2,時間狀語:yet, already ,just, never, ever, so far, by now, since + 時間點,for + 時間段,recently, lately,in the past few years, etc.
3,基本結構:主語 + have/has + p.p(過去分詞) + 其它
4,否定形式:主語 + have/has + not + p.p(過去分詞) + 其它
5,一般疑問句:have或has放句首。

這部分內容主要考察的是過去將來專完成進行時知屬識點:
表示動作從過去某一時間開始一直延續到對於過去來說的將來某一時間,動作是否繼續下去,由上下文決定。過去將來完成進行時是由should/would have been + v-ing構成;否定形式should/would+not have been + v-ing;疑問形式是將should/would提前。
過去將來完成進行時的情態意義,「would have been+現在分詞」結構除用於表示過去將來完成進行時外,有時其中的 would 也可能是情態動詞,具有情態意義,比較表示推測或猜想等。
如:「What interesting job have you found?」 Helen asked him; he knew she would have been thinking about it.「你找到什麼有趣的工作啦?」海倫向他問道。他知道海倫一定會一直想這件事的。

1. Anthropology: the scientific study of the human race, especially of its
origins, development, customs and beliefs
2. Archaeology: the study of the buried remains of the ancient times, such
3. as houses, pots, tools, and weapons
4. Ecology: the study of the relations of plants, animals, and people to
each other and to their surroundings
5. Geology: the study of rocks, soils, etc. which make up the Earth, and of
their changes ring the history of the world
6. Ideology: a set of ideas that an economic or political system is based
on
7. Musicology: the study of the history and theory of music
8. Psychology: the scientific study of the mind and how it influences
behavior
9. Sociology: the scientific study of the nature and development of
society and social behavior
10. Zoology: the scientific study of animals and their behaviour

Human beings live in the realm of nature. They are not only dwellers in
nature, but also transformers of it. With the development of society and
its economy, people tend to become less dependent on nature directly, but
indirectly their dependence grows. Human beings are connected with
nature by "blood" ties. No one can live outside nature. However, the
previous dynamic balance between man and nature has shown signs of
breaking down. Problems such as the population explosion, ecological
imbalance and the shortage of natural resources have become major
factors keeping human society from being further developed. Professor
Spirkin holds that the only choice for human beings is the wise
organization of proction and care for Mother Nature.
